Transaction 511691ffd52dd5024101d730aaa1d46551aec2404a73715c91968bbdae1a20d7

2 Input
2 Outputs
  • 511691ffd52dd5024101d730aaa1d46551aec2404a73715c91968bbdae1a20d7:0
  • value  1648063
    address  3Bw9jY9q4GiLFL86BkwX6iqphdLejahPVp
  • 511691ffd52dd5024101d730aaa1d46551aec2404a73715c91968bbdae1a20d7:1
  • value  5045573
    address  12aYTZFHTp3vypGq9Kzidox7UwKDrwtgjb